What Does “No Wagering” Actually Mean for UK Bingo?
It means exactly what it says. You deposit £10. You get a bonus of £10 in bingo tickets. You win £50 on a full house. That £50 is yours. No 40x wagering requirement. No max withdrawal cap (within reason). No “bonus funds” that evaporate into thin air.
But here is where it gets complicated. From what I’ve seen, many sites that claim “no wagering” still have a catch. They give you free spins on slots with a 1x playthrough. That is not truly no wagering. A genuine no wagering bingo site gives you the winnings from the bingo games themselves as withdrawable cash immediately. The slots part is a separate animal.
For the 2026 UK market, the best bingo sites no wagering 2026 uk keep winnings offers are primarily focused on bingo room prizes. The slots side often still has some terms. But the bingo portion? Clean as a whistle.

Deposit Limits and Self-Exclusion: The Real Safety Net
I am not here to just hype bonuses. I want to talk about the tools that matter. Every UKGC-licensed bingo site must offer deposit limits. But the implementation varies wildly.
PlayOJO lets you set daily, weekly, and monthly deposit limits in the cashier menu. You can reduce them instantly. Increasing them takes 24 hours. That is good practice.
Bet365 Bingo has a “Reality Check” popup that fires every 30 minutes. You can set it to 15 minutes if you want. I recommend you do. It is easy to lose track of time in a 90-ball marathon.
888 Ladies Bingo offers a “Time Out” feature for 24 hours up to 6 weeks. Self-exclusion is available through GAMSTOP integration. But I noticed something odd. The self-exclusion link is buried three menus deep. That is not ideal. A responsible operator should have it on the footer of every page. They do not. That is a black mark.

Reality Checks and Cooling-Off Periods
I set up a test account on each platform. I played for 45 minutes. I tracked how many reality checks I received.
- PlayOJO: 2 popups. One at 30 minutes, one at 45 minutes. Both paused the game until I acknowledged them. Good.
- Bet365 Bingo: 1 popup at 30 minutes. It did not pause the game. I could click “OK” without reading it. Bad.
- 888 Ladies Bingo: 0 popups. I had to manually check the “My Account” section to see my session time. Unacceptable.
